How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 98661?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
98661 Studio Apartments | $1,619 | $1,092 | $2,753 |
98661 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,810 | $845 | $3,951 |
98661 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,092 | $1,170 | $7,471 |
98661 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,140 | $1,300 | $3,965 |
98661 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,354 | $1,810 | $2,741 |
